Transaction 20fa078a91f2d9b29be5978244a674a395673a7fe25a03783252fc41588a7b27

2 Input
1 Outputs
  • 20fa078a91f2d9b29be5978244a674a395673a7fe25a03783252fc41588a7b27:0
  • value  514993
    address  1AZwRNCY63CXPYcAGXqghTE8TV24XQC7HU